Heavy rainfall is not the only reason for flooding. Interior concerns like burst pipes as well as overflows can result in emergency situation flooding. This will likewise create damage to your residential property. Failure to address the problem will escalate the damage as well as enhance the possibilities of mold and mildew growth. Keep on reviewing to find out what you can when dealing with emergency flooding.

1. Turn Off Main Water Valve

Pipelines can rupture due to freezing temperatures, high pressure, blockage, water heating system concerns, and other variables. No matter the reason, you need to act rapidly to make certain porous residence materials, home appliances, and also furnishings do not take in the water, resulting in damages.

2. Shut down the Circuit Breaker

With a large flood, you need to see to it the power is out. Water is a conductor, and if it reaches your electrical outlets, it can trigger injuries or fatalities. Turn off the breaker to prevent electrocution. If you can not do it, make a fast call to the power business to shut the main line. Keep the power off up until excess water is gone.

3. Relocate Important Wet Times

When it pertains to saving your home furnishings as well as home appliances, time is of the essence. Thus, you must relocate whatever whet belongings you can from the afflicted area to a dry area. This discourages further damages due to the fact that the longer they take in water, the more substantial the problem.

4. Document the Level of Damages

Keep in mind of all the damages brought upon by the burst pipe. You can jot down notes, take photos, and collect videos. This is a wonderful method to supply evidence to accumulate insurance claims on your house insurance coverage. With paperwork, you can likewise get a clear photo of the extent of the damage.

5. Eliminate Water ASAP

You should do away with excess water as soon as possible. Ought to there be a large quantity of standing water, you might need a water pump for extraction. You can rent this devices if you do not own one. If it's late at night, the convention container technique likewise works. Use several pails and manual work to take it out. When marginal water is left, you can take in the rest with old t shirts or towels. You may likewise need to remove broken products like rugs and carpets.

6. Dry the Area

You can also establish up electrical fans and also put them in the toughest setup. A dehumidifier additionally functions in taking out moisture to avoid mildew and mold and mildews.

7. Collaborate with Professionals

When you endure substantial water damage due to emergency situation flooding from a ruptured pipe, you can work with a restoration specialist to reconstruct and renovate your residence. Above all, do not fail to remember to call a respectable plumbing professional to take care of the burst pipeline as well as check the rest of your piping system. Enduring the Imperfect Tornado: Tips for Emergency Situation Preparations



If you stay in a storm-prone location, you must be made use of now on what to do, where to go and also what to have to be prepared for bad weather. If you're not made use of to obtaining pounded by high winds and hard rainfall, you probably don't have an concept how best to encounter a tornado circumstance.

For starters, storms do not just come without a warning. Weather stations keep an eye on the environment everyday. If a storm is possible, they will certainly issue 2 sorts of cautions:

Storm watch-- is released when there is a possible storm in your location. You probably will be experiencing a dark, cloudy skies, an uncommonly gusty day and also some rain. The storm might or may not come, however this is the time to keep tuned to your neighborhood radio for information and also updates.

Storm caution-- is released when a tornado is headed towards your area. By that time, the roads might be swamped and web traffic is poor. You don't desire to be captured in your car in negative weather condition.

Snowstorm-- generally occurs in wintertime and also suggests hefty snow, strong winds as well as wind cool. When a warning is released, stay clear of taking a trip as high as possible as well as stay inside. There is no usage revealing on your own outdoors where you might obtain caught in web traffic or in locations where you will be hard to get to or even worse, discover.

Points do not constantly go poor throughout storms, but climate is unpredictable as well as anything can occur. To help you prepare for a storm emergency situation, below are a few suggestions:

Spruce up.
Put on enough garments to keep yourself cozy. Warmth may not be available in your home so obtain extra coats as well as coverings to keep your body temperature adequately. Have your mittens, handwear covers, hats, socks and boots all set.

Have food prepared.
Emergency situation arrangements are a have to during storm emergencies. If the storm gets too poor and also the streets are swamped, you will have a difficulty going out to the grocery shops.

Keep bottles of water helpful. Tidy water might be tough ahead by throughout actually bad conditions and also the worst point you can do is suffer from dehydration since you were not prepared. Maintain a supply of a minimum of one gallon for every person daily that will last for 3 to 4 days.

Fill up the tub.
You'll require a lot more water for washing and flushing the commodes. When the power is out, your water pump will not run, so best fill your tub, water containers as well as pails with water. If you have small children in the house, take preventative measures by covering deep containers and keeping youngsters far from the restroom unless essential.

Emergency package
Have a clinical or first kit ready and also make sure it's freshly-stocked. It needs to contain anti-bacterials, gauzes, cotton spheres, Q-tips, medicated plasters and necessary medications. It's likewise a excellent idea to have one more set in your vehicle.

If anyone in your family members is under special medication, make certain you have sufficient materials to last till after the tornado mores than and medication stores are open.

Lights off
Expect power failures throughout tornado emergencies. You will not have any type of electricity, so supply on candles, flashlights and also emergency lights. Have extra fresh batteries as well as matches in case you run out.

If you can't switch on the TV, have a battery-powered radio tuned in to a station that covers your area. Media will keep track of the tornado and also will certainly maintain you updated.

You may need warm water throughout the duration when power is not yet readily available, so maintain a small storage tank of gas about just in case. Your exterior barbecue grill will certainly do well.

Get an alternative sanctuary.
If you believe your residence will experience substantially, it's a excellent idea to consider an alternating shelter. It could be an emptying center or one more home or building that is safer. Ensure you have enough gas in your container in case you require to get out of the house and also action someplace. Maintain to a higher ground where you have far better opportunities of being risk-free and completely dry.
